Annals of Ireland. Three fragments, copied from ancient sources by Dubhaltach MacFirbisigh; and edited, with a translation and notes, from a manuscript preserved in the Burgundian Library at Brussels is an unchanged, high-quality reprint of the original edition of 1860.
